Deal Island Boat Ramp
Water access to Upper Thorofare Creek. Marina, dock, pump-out, parking area, portable restrooms. Managed by the Somerset County Roads Department. Usage fee: Free.

The really cool thing is that during oyster season, at least, several skipjacks of various sizes and vintage are tied off there. The folks who visit clearly have the ecology and environment in mind. Close by a huge pile of oyster shells is a hand-painted sign: " Leave only footprints"
The shoreline is clean and I saw little evidence of trash left behind by visitors l. It's a great spot to be outdoors on the water, where you can launch a boat. But I don't know the protocol or who you need to see before launching, but I suspect it's pretty straightforward.
